Comprehending Sash Windows
Sash windows are typically defined by their sliding system, where one or more panels, or "sashes," relocation vertically to open and close. They are frequently related to Georgian, Victorian, and Edwardian architecture, and their visual appeal goes beyond mere function; they inform a story of workmanship and design from a bygone period.
